Sage Intacct Implementation information

Is Sage Intacct an ERP or accounting software?

Sage Intacct is primarily cloud-based accounting software that offers financial management and automation features. It is often considered an ERP system because it integrates core financial processes and can be expanded with additional modules for broader enterprise resource planning functions. As a Sage Intacct implementation specialist, understanding its role as both accounting software and ERP is important for effective deployment.

How long does Sage Intacct implementation take?

The implementation of Sage Intacct typically takes between 4 to 12 weeks, depending on the complexity of the organization's processes and the scope of customization required. A Sage Intacct implementation specialist or project manager usually oversees the process, which includes planning, configuration, data migration, and testing phases.

How much does Sage implementation cost?

The cost of Sage Intacct implementation for a Sage Intacct Implementation role varies depending on the scope, complexity, and size of the project, typically ranging from $20,000 to $100,000 or more. Factors influencing cost include customization, integration requirements, and the level of training needed, with larger or more complex organizations generally incurring higher expenses. Implementation costs also depend on whether the project is handled in-house or by a third-party consulting firm.

What are some common challenges faced during a Sage Intacct implementation, and how can new team members effectively address them?

One of the most common challenges in Sage Intacct implementation is aligning the software's capabilities with the client's existing business processes and requirements. New team members can effectively address this by collaborating closely with both the client and internal project managers to thoroughly map out workflows and anticipate integration needs. Open communication and proactive problem-solving during data migration, system configuration, and user training are crucial to minimizing setbacks. Regular check-ins and documentation also help ensure that the project stays on track and that any issues are addressed promptly.

What is Sage Intacct implementation?

Sage Intacct implementation is the process of setting up and configuring the Sage Intacct cloud-based accounting software for an organization’s specific needs. This typically involves data migration, customizing workflows, integrating with other business systems, and training staff to use the platform effectively. The goal is to ensure a smooth transition from legacy systems to Sage Intacct so that all financial processes run efficiently and accurately. A successful implementation helps organizations gain better financial visibility, improve efficiency, and support growth.

What is the implementation process of Sage Intacct?

The Sage Intacct implementation process typically involves planning, system design, configuration, data migration, testing, training, and go-live. Implementation specialists often use project management tools and require knowledge of accounting processes and software customization. A structured approach ensures a smooth transition and optimal system performance.

Job description

Company Description

Sage Intacct is 100% invested in meeting the needs of financial professionals, 100% focused on customer success, and 100% committed to the cloud. That's who we are, and always will be. More than 11,000 organizations rely on Sage Intacct's best-in-class cloud ERP software to deliver the efficiencies and insights that keep them on the fast track of growth, from their first million to their first billion, and beyond.

Job Description

The Sales Engineer will present Intacct's solution offerings and architecture to SMB prospects and customers.  The Sales Engineer will be responsible for evoking confidence in Intacct's functionality and technology infrastructure, and removing all technical objections in the sales cycle.  The Sales Engineer will uncover business requirements, develop a solution sales strategy, and create and effectively demonstrate Intacct's solutions that address customer requirements.

  • Clearly articulate the benefits of Intacct's solutions to all levels including lines of business managers and "C" level executives
  • Understand the customer need and establish Intacct's solution as the best solution that addresses their need
  • Develop, present and deliver high-impact demonstrations of the Intacct solution
  • Support Corporate and Channel Sales Representatives in production of high quality sales proposals and supporting materials
  • Meet quarterly and annual quota objectives working in tandem with the Corporate and Channel Sales Representatives
  • Provide input to other cross-functional departments pertaining to prospect requests and product enhancements as needed



Qualifications
  • 2-5 years experience as a pre-sales engineer with implementation consulting or customer support for an accounting or financial software application.
  • Bachelors degree in computer science, finance, accounting, business or related fields
  • In depth knowledge of accounting (or demonstrable experience of accounting processes)
  • Solid oral, written, presentation and interpersonal communication skills
  • Proven track record of increasing deal size and accelerating the sales cycle
  • Successful quota achievement
  • Familiar with internet application software, XML and web services
